E. J3 PLUS BACK TRANSIT SAFETY
A. CENTER OF GRAVITY
Installing a back support on a wheelchair may effect the
center of gravity of the wheelchair, and may cause the
wheelchair to tip backwards potentially resulting in
injury to the user.
B. ANTI-TIPS
Anti-tip tubes can help keep your chair from tipping over
backward in normal conditions.
1. Sunrise recommends the use of anti-tip tubes.
2. ALWAYS assess the need for anti-tips or an
amputee axle adapter brackets that could be
added to the wheelchair to help increase the
stability of the wheelchair and seating system.
If you fail to heed these warnings, damage to your chair,
a fall, tip-over, or loss of control may occur and cause
severe injury to the rider or others.

D. COMPATIBILITY
The J3 Plus Back is designed to be compatible with most
wheelchairs with the following exception:
1. Wheelchairs that are angle adjustable with
recline or tilt, and result in a back angle
greater than 60 from the vertical.
The J3 Plus Back has been dynamically tested for use
in a motor vehicle. This system conforms with
ANSI/RESNA WC-20. If the J3 Plus Back is to be used in
a transit situation, it must be mounted to a wheelchair
that conforms to the performance requirements of ANSI/
RESNA WC-19. For rider safety, please follow all
installation, use, and maintenance instructions within this
manual as well as the transit instructions below.
1. If possible and feasible, the rider should transfer to
the Original Equipment Manufacturer vehicle seat
and use the vehicle restraints.
2. The distance between the top of the user's
shoulder and the top of the back should not exceed
6.5" (16.5 cm).
3. The wheelchair must be labeled as appropriate for
use as a seat in a motor vehicle, dynamically tested
to the performance requirements of ISO Standard
7176-19 and installed, used, and maintained
according to the manufacturer's instructions.
4. If the original wheelchair seat was replaced, the
new seat must be approved for wheelchair transit,
installed and used as indicated in the manufacturer's
instructions.
5. The Wheelchair Tiedown and Occupant Restraint
System (WTORS) should be compatible with the
specific wheelchair, used as indicated in the
manufacturer's instructions, and should comply
with the performance requirements of ISO
Standard 10542.
6. The wheelchair must be forward facing during
transport.
7. In order to reduce the potential of injury to vehicle
occupants, wheelchair-mounted accessories such as
trays and respiratory equipment should be
removed and secured separately.
8. This product is intended for use by adults up to
500 lbs. (227 kg)
9. Postural support devices such as pelvic positioning
belts, anterior trunk supports, or postural supports
such as lateral trunk supports should not be relied
on for occupant restraint in a moving vehicle unless
they are labeled as conforming to ISO Standard
16840-4.

A. MAINTENANCE AND CLEANING
1. Proper maintenance and cleaning will improve
performance and extend the useful life of your
equipment.
2. Clean your equipment regularly. This will help you
find loose or worn parts and make your
equipment easier to use. You will need a mild
detergent solution and cleaning rags.
3. If discovered, have loose, worn, bent, or damaged
parts replaced before using the J3 Plus Back.
B. CRITICAL SAFETY CHECKS
1. Fasteners
Sunrise Medical recommends that all fasteners be
checked for wear, such as loose bolts or broken
components every 6 months. Loose fasteners
should be re-tightened according to the installation
instructions.
2. Replacing Components
Contact your Authorized Dealer immediately to
replace any components. Do not continue to use
the system after identifying loose or broken
components.

D. REMOVAL AND REPLACEMENT
After installation/adjustment, the back can be easily
removed from the wheelchair if necessary.
1. Removal:
a. Push both release levers forward to
unlock the hardware. (Fig. 4)
b. Once both levers are in the forward
position, lift the back straight up,
using the handle located on the top
of the back.
2. Proper re-attachment after removal:
a. To re-attach the back and hardware
receivers, line up the pins to the
receivers.
b. Push the back into place on the
receivers.
c. If properly inserted, the pins will
"click" into a locked position.
3. Locking Pins:
The locking pins provide a safety feature which
prevents the back from being released
unintentionally from the wheelchair.
a. To lock, insert the pins (A) into the
mounting receivers (B).
b. Remove the pins if the quick-release
capability is desired. If you are uncertain that you have heard the locking
"click", pull up on the back using the handle to test
and make sure it has been securely locked.
If you fail to heed this warning, damage to your
equipment, a fall, or loss of control may occur and
cause severe injury to the rider or others.

A. WHEELCHAIR DIMENSIONS
1. The J3 Plus Back is designed to replace the
wheelchair's sling upholstery. Prior to
installation, determine if the wheelchair used
has compatible back canes by measuring the
width between your back canes as seen in
Fig. 5.
2. Next check that the back canes are a
compatible diameter. The J3 Plus back hard-
ware can mounted on wheelchair back canes
ranging from 3/4" to 1-1/8". Measure your
back cane diameter (Fig. 6) and refer to
Table 2 to ensure your back canes are
compatible.
3. If you cannot determine that the back canes
are compatible, please contact your Authorized
Sunrise Medical Dealer or Sunrise
Medical customer service.

A. J3 TH HARDWARE
Please read the following instructions before beginning the
installation. To install the J3 Plus Back with TH hardware,
it is best to begin without a user in the wheelchair. Once
the back has been installed, the user can be seated back in
the wheelchair for minor adjustments.
1. Tools Required (included with J3 Plus Back):
a. 4mm hex key
b. 10mm box end wrench
B. BACK HARDWARE INSTALLATION
1. Remove existing back components
a. Remove the existing wheelchair
back according to the wheelchair
manufacturer's instructions.
b. Remove any pre-existing back
hardware or components.
2. Locating the hardware receiver
a. The backshell should come with
mounting brackets (A) attached.
b. Visually determine the optimum
clamp receiver location (B) on
the back canes. The mounting
hardware should be at
approximately equal heights on
each back post (Fig. 7) and
parallel to the seat frame (Fig. 8).
78910
NOTE - A higher location on the back canes
is generally better.
3. Attaching the hardware receivers
a. Using the 4mm hex key, loosen the
clamp screws (Fig. 9) (C)
NOTE - For large tube diameters, the
clamp screws may have to be removed
completely.
b. Attach and align the receiver to the
wheelchair back canes (D).
c. Hand-tighten the clamp screws (C).
d. The receivers may require additional
lateral adjustments to ensure proper
alignment.
4. Attaching and aligning the J3 Plus Back shell
a. Using a 10mm wrench, loosen the
bracket nuts (E) and mounting pin bolts
(H) until the hardware can move easily
in all directions.
